web前端端是什么
-
Web前端是指通过使用HTML、CSS和JavaScript等技术来构建和优化网页的过程和技术领域。它是一种关注用户界面的开发工作,旨在提供用户友好、易于使用和高效的网站和应用程序。
Web前端开发的工作内容主要包括以下几个方面:
-
HTML:HTML是一种用于描述网页结构的标记语言。Web前端开发人员使用HTML来创建网页的结构和内容,包括标题、段落、列表、图片、链接等。
-
CSS:CSS是一种用于描述网页样式和布局的样式表语言。Web前端开发人员使用CSS来设置网页的样式,包括颜色、字体、间距、边框等,并实现页面的布局。
-
JavaScript:JavaScript是一种用于添加交互和动态效果的脚本语言。Web前端开发人员使用JavaScript来实现网页的交互功能,例如表单验证、动画效果、页面逻辑等。
-
响应式设计:在移动互联网时代,响应式设计成为重要的考虑因素。Web前端开发人员需要确保网页在不同设备上都能正常显示和操作,例如在手机、平板电脑和桌面电脑上。
-
浏览器兼容性:不同的浏览器对Web标准的支持存在差异,Web前端开发人员需要确保网页在各种主流浏览器上都能正常工作,包括谷歌浏览器、火狐浏览器、Safari等。
除了上述基本技术之外,Web前端开发人员还需要熟悉一些相关的工具和框架,例如前端开发工具(如代码编辑器、调试工具)、版本控制系统(如Git)、前端框架(例如React、Vue.js)等,以提升开发效率并实现更好的用户体验。
总之,Web前端开发在现代互联网应用中扮演着重要的角色,它负责构建用户界面、实现交互功能和优化用户体验,对于提升网站和应用程序的质量和性能至关重要。
1年前 -
-
Web前端指的是网页前端开发,也称为前端开发或前端工程师。它是指负责网站或Web应用程序用户界面的设计和开发的技术领域。Web前端开发包括使用HTML、CSS和JavaScript等技术来构建网站和Web应用程序的用户界面。
-
网站界面设计:Web前端开发负责设计和开发网站的用户界面。这包括创建网站的各个页面,包括首页、导航菜单、内容页面和表单等。
-
响应式设计:Web前端开发需要确保网站可以适应不同的设备和屏幕大小。这意味着网站应该能够在电脑、手机和平板电脑等设备上显示良好,并且自动调整页面布局和大小。
-
网站性能优化:Web前端开发需要优化网站的性能,以确保网站加载速度快。这包括文件压缩、图片优化、缓存设置和代码优化等。
-
浏览器兼容性:Web前端开发需要确保网站在不同的浏览器上都能正常运行。由于不同浏览器对网页代码的解析方式可能有所不同,因此开发人员需要进行测试和调试,以确保在各种浏览器上都具有一致的显示效果。
-
与后端开发人员的合作:Web前端开发通常需要与后端开发人员密切合作。前端开发人员负责处理用户界面的设计和交互,而后端开发人员负责处理数据和业务逻辑。因此,良好的沟通和合作能力是Web前端开发人员的重要技能。
总之,Web前端开发是一项关键的技术领域,它负责设计和开发网站和Web应用程序的用户界面。它涉及许多方面,包括界面设计、响应式设计、性能优化、浏览器兼容性和与后端开发人员的合作。
1年前 -
-
Web前端是指通过HTML、CSS和JavaScript等技术,将网页的用户界面呈现给用户,并与用户进行交互的工作。Web前端开发的目标是构建良好的用户体验,使用户可以方便地访问和使用网页。
Web前端工作的主要内容包括构建网页的结构、样式和交互效果。Web前端需要了解HTML、CSS和JavaScript等技术,掌握各种前端开发工具和框架,以及了解用户体验设计和用户界面设计的基本原理。
下面是Web前端工作的一般流程和方法。
-
确定需求:与产品经理或项目经理沟通,了解项目需求和用户需求,并明确任务目标。
-
设计界面:根据需求设计网页的结构、布局和样式。这个过程可以使用设计工具如Photoshop或Sketch来创建原型图,以便更好地与设计师和其他团队成员进行沟通。
-
编写HTML:使用HTML标记语言创建网页的结构。HTML是网页的基本构建块,用来定义网页的内容和结构。
-
编写CSS:使用CSS样式表来美化网页的外观。CSS决定了网页中元素的颜色、字体、大小、位置等属性。
-
添加交互效果:使用JavaScript编写脚本来实现网页的交互效果,如响应用户的点击、滚动或输入。JavaScript可以改变网页的内容、样式和行为,使网页更具交互性和动态性。
-
测试和优化:对编写的网页进行测试,确保在不同浏览器和设备上的兼容性和稳定性。根据测试结果和用户反馈,对网页进行优化,提高性能和用户体验。
-
上线发布:完成网页的开发和测试后,将网页部署到服务器上,使用户可以通过浏览器访问和使用。
以上是Web前端开发的基本工作流程。在实际工作中,前端开发可能还需要与后端开发人员进行协作,适应不同的项目和团队需求,持续学习新的技术和工具,不断提升自己的能力和水平。
1年前 -